Understanding Of Insurance Management in Personal Finance

Life is full of risks. You can try to avoid them or reduce their likelihood and consequences, but you cannot eliminate them. You can, however, pay someone to share them. That is the idea behind insurance.

A key component of any financial plan should be planning for unexpected events that may prevent you from meeting your future financial goals. This is known as risk management planning. Each year many people face financial disaster through premature death, disability or a prolonged illness. As part of your financial plan we review your current insurance coverage for potential shortfalls. Where appropriate we make specific insurance recommendations to better protect you and your loved ones from financial catastrophe.

Insurance can be purchased for your property and your home, your health, your employment, and your life. In each case, you weigh the cost of the consequence of a risk that may never actually happen against the cost of insuring against it. Deciding what and how to insure is really a process of deciding what the costs of loss would be and how willing you are to pay to get rid of those risks.

The costs of insurance can also be lowered through risk avoidance or reduction strategies. Risk avoidance is accomplished by completely avoiding the risk through such measures as choosing not to smoke or avoiding an activity that might cause injury. Risk reduction reduces the risk of injury, loss, or illness. For example, installing an alarm system in your home may reduce homeowner’s insurance premiums because that reduces the risk of theft. Of course, installing an alarm system has a cost too. Risk assumption is when one assumes responsibility for a loss or injury instead of pursuing insurance.

Why Insurance Management is Important In Personal Finance?

For instance, assume that you’ve worked out an exceptionally good financial plan including a careful selection of low risk and high return savings and investment options. Your ultimate end goal is to purchase a dream home for your family and to save up for retirement. If something were to happen to you, such as an accident, a disability, or even death, it can throw your entire plan up for a toss. In addition to that, your family would also end up losing their primary source of income, thereby putting them under great financial distress.

An insurance plan can avoid all of this worry. It can keep you and your family protected from such situations by acting as a major source of income during such trying times.

let’s take a look at some of the reasons why you should include this product in your plan right away.........

  • Insurance can help you meet debt obligations: Even when you lose the ability to generate income due to an adverse event, your debt burden still remains intact. Without an income source, it might become tough for you to pay off your obligations on time. Insurance comes to your aid under such a situation. The payout you receive from the insurer can be used to settle your debt obligations without causing any significant financial distress to you or your family.
  • It helps with your retirement planning: By purchasing the best Life Insurance plan to meet your long-term goals, you can even enjoy the benefits of retirement planning. In plans like endowment policies and ULIPs, you get to enjoy maturity benefits that can serve as a reliable corpus to start your retirement phase. You can even opt for pension plans that give you the option to receive lump sum payouts or periodic payments.

  • Health Insurance covers medical costs: Medical expenses can become overwhelming very quickly, especially given the rising costs of healthcare. With a Health Insurance plan, you can meet these expenses without any significant financial stress. Medical insurance generally covers various costs like hospitalization expenses, home care expenses, day care procedures and ambulance charges.

  • Insurance can also act as an investment option: While insurance plans are designed to offer you protection against losses and other untoward incidents, they can also act as an investment option. Unit Linked Insurance Plans (ULIPs) in addition to providing a protective cover also gives you handsome returns on your investment. Insurance plans with endowment benefits can also be a good option for investors looking to get something out of their investment, while staying indemnified from losses.

  • Financial security: By compensating for the loss that you suffer in an emergency, insurance policies provide financial security. You are secured in the knowledge that if an emergency strikes, the insurance policy would shoulder the loss. This helps you plan your finances and accumulate a corpus for your goals. It also ensures that the planned corpus is secured and is not used in emergencies.
  • Conclusion: Knowing how relevant insurance is, it’s best to purchase life and health insurance plans as early as you can. This is because the premiums for these kinds of insurance generally increase as you age. Aside from these types of insurance, it’s also a good idea to invest in motor insurance and home insurance if you own a vehicle or a house.

When buying insurance, opting for optimal coverage is important. Here are some simple formulae to consider

  • Term insurance 

Opt for a sum assured of at least 10 to 12 times your annual income. For instance, if your annual income is 25 lakh $, you need coverage of at least  2.5 $ to 3 crore $.

  • Health insurance

Opt for a sum insured which is equal to 50% of your annual income and the aggregated hospital bills over the last three years.

So, if your annual income is 25 lakh $ and you have suffered hospitalization over the past three years the bill of which amounted to 2.5 lakh $, your sum insured should be at least 15 lakh $.

Remember, these are basic calculations that do not take into consideration other variables. Ideally, the coverage should depend on your financial needs that can be ascertained from different factors. Some such factors are as follows: 

  • Your lifestyle expenses
  • The number of dependents that you have
  • Existing assets and liabilities 
  • Your financial responsibilities or goals

So, when buying insurance, do not make a hasty decision. Assess how much coverage you need and then pick the right plan.
